My Project

Lab days are the days that get my students excited about school. They enjoy the hands-on activities, and I am thrilled that they are motivated about learning since there is always a scientific principle tied into the activity. During the year we build hot air balloons (Gas Laws), make ice cream (freezing point depression), and produce slime (polymers). A majority of our labs involve the use of hot plates. We use the hot plates to get materials to the proper temperature. Unfortunately, we do not have enough hot plates to go around. We have to double up our lab groups and as a result we have more students simply observing the activity rather than taking part. If we had two more hot plates more of our students could benefit from the activities.

I have great students that really get excited about lab days.

I try to make learning exciting as a means of inspiring them to consider careers in science. Two hot plates would go a long way towards making this dream come true.
